Really gorgeous French restaurant in Kentish. The atmosphere feels relaxed chic and tables are spaced nicely. Service attentive and friendly. Drinks Wine selection is good, cocktails very good (we had aperol spritz & the sour epicé, a Mezcal sour, which I thoroughly recommended. Food Between four we shared the deep fried dauphinois (divine), baked st. Michelin, and then shared the sides with our mains of green beans in garlic, braised red cabbage & two frites portions (one with aoli, one with garlic butter). All the mains were divine, the duck was cooked to perfection and the mushroom ragout was incredibly flavoured. The steak was also excellent and served to our liking. While portions are on the smaller side - and it would be nice that the meals came with a sauce as quite dry otherwise - they do not skimp on the desserts. You'll be hard pressed to find as comforting a rhubarb crumble as you will here, & the creme brulée had a satisfying snap & excellent flavour. For a filling and delicious taste of France, you really can't go wrong here.

Short walk from Kentish town tub station. Some seating in the street. Another reviewer mentioned the dull lighting was romantic. For mine it was hard to read the menu because it was so dark. Had to use my mobile phone light. Had a couple of excellent cocktails and entree of cheese and steak tartare - Both delicious. Mains of duck (slightly dry), rainbow trout (excellent)and a glass of white wine. £105 for 2. For the price the service could have been more attentive.
